The International
Veterinary Acupuncture Society IVAS states that acupuncture is indicated mainly for functional problems such as those that involve paralysis, noninfectious inflammation (e.g., allergies), and pain, including musculoskeletal problems such as arthritis or vertebral disc pathology; skin problems such as lick granuloma; respiratory problems like feline asthma; gastrointestinal problems such as diarrhea; and selected reproductiv

L. «Practice of
veterinary medicine» means the diagnosis and treatment of animal diseases by traditional methods which
include but are not limited to prescribing drugs and medication, administering techniques and procedures
including surgical procedures, and other methods which
include but are not limited to chiropractic, physical therapy,
acupuncture, acupressure, homeopathy, therapeutic massage, dentistry, and embryo transfer.
